A Kansas resident with confirmed measles was at Kansas City International Airport on November 5 (2 a.m.–noon) and November 10 (2 a.m.–4 a.m.), prompting a health alert.
The Kansas City Health Department says those exposed may develop symptoms—fever, cough, runny nose, red eyes, and rash—between November 12 and December 1.
The risk is low for those vaccinated with the MMR shot.
Officials urge unvaccinated individuals to get vaccinated and anyone with symptoms to seek medical advice.
